Emissions on agricultural land — Emissions (CO2eq) in Turkmenistan
Turkmenistan: Emissions on agricultural land — Emissions (CO2eq) was 17,726 kt in 2023. ▲ Rising
Emissions on agricultural land — Emissions (CO2eq) in Turkmenistan, 1992–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
In 2023, emissions on agricultural land — emissions (co2eq) in Turkmenistan stood at 17,726 kt. That is the highest value across all 32 years on record.
The figure is up 0.3% on the previous year and up 22.0% over ten years.
Over the whole period, emissions on agricultural land — emissions (co2eq) in Turkmenistan peaked at 17,726 kt in 2023 and was at its lowest, 4,714 kt, in 1992.
Turkmenistan ranks 73rd of 222 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 32 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
